| 22 /* <DESC> | |
| 23 * one way to set the necessary OpenSSL locking callbacks if you want to do | |
| 24 * multi-threaded transfers with HTTPS/FTPS with libcurl built to use OpenSSL. | |
| 25 * </DESC> | |
| 26 */ | |
| 27 /* | |
| 28 * This is not a complete stand-alone example. | |
| 29 * | |
| 30 * Author: Jeremy Brown | |
| 31 */ | |
| 32 | |
| 33 #include <stdio.h> | |
| 34 #include <pthread.h> | |
| 35 #include <openssl/err.h> | |
| 36 | |
| 37 #define MUTEX_TYPE pthread_mutex_t | |
| 38 #define MUTEX_SETUP(x) pthread_mutex_init(&(x), NULL) | |
| 39 #define MUTEX_CLEANUP(x) pthread_mutex_destroy(&(x)) | |
| 40 #define MUTEX_LOCK(x) pthread_mutex_lock(&(x)) | |
| 41 #define MUTEX_UNLOCK(x) pthread_mutex_unlock(&(x)) | |
| 42 #define THREAD_ID pthread_self() | |
| 43 | |
| 44 | |
| 45 void handle_error(const char *file, int lineno, const char *msg) | |
| 46 { | |
| 47 fprintf(stderr, "** %s:%d %s\n", file, lineno, msg); | |
| 48 ERR_print_errors_fp(stderr); | |
| 49 /* exit(-1); */ | |
| 50 } | |
| 51 | |
| 52 /* This array will store all of the mutexes available to OpenSSL. */ | |
| 53 static MUTEX_TYPE *mutex_buf = NULL; | |
| 54 | |
| 55 static void locking_function(int mode, int n, const char *file, int line) | |
| 56 { | |
| 57 if(mode & CRYPTO_LOCK) | |
| 58 MUTEX_LOCK(mutex_buf[n]); | |
| 59 else | |
| 60 MUTEX_UNLOCK(mutex_buf[n]); | |
| 61 } | |
| 62 | |
| 63 static unsigned long id_function(void) | |
| 64 { | |
| 65 return ((unsigned long)THREAD_ID); | |
| 66 } | |
| 67 | |
| 68 int thread_setup(void) | |
| 69 { | |
| 70 int i; | |
| 71 | |
| 72 mutex_buf = malloc(CRYPTO_num_locks() * sizeof(MUTEX_TYPE)); | |
| 73 if(!mutex_buf) | |
| 74 return 0; | |
| 75 for(i = 0; i < CRYPTO_num_locks(); i++) | |
| 76 MUTEX_SETUP(mutex_buf[i]); | |
| 77 CRYPTO_set_id_callback(id_function); | |
| 78 CRYPTO_set_locking_callback(locking_function); | |
| 79 return 1; | |
| 80 } | |
| 81 | |
| 82 int thread_cleanup(void) | |
| 83 { | |
| 84 int i; | |
| 85 | |
| 86 if(!mutex_buf) | |
| 87 return 0; | |
| 88 CRYPTO_set_id_callback(NULL); | |
| 89 CRYPTO_set_locking_callback(NULL); | |
| 90 for(i = 0; i < CRYPTO_num_locks(); i++) | |
| 91 MUTEX_CLEANUP(mutex_buf[i]); | |
| 92 free(mutex_buf); | |
| 93 mutex_buf = NULL; | |
| 94 return 1; | |
| 95 } |
